Why incoterms comparison for buyers matters on the Diamond Plus
Ex works looks cheap until customs, handling and destination charges are added back.
Freight consolidation changes the answer to incoterms comparison for buyers at container scale, which is why small and large buyers reach different conclusions.
Delivered terms simplify budgeting but remove visibility of the freight cost build up.

Frequently asked questions
Which incoterm suits a first Diamond Plus order?
Buyers without a broker usually prefer a delivered term for the first shipment, then move to FOB once the lane is established.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
